GOGL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review
167 of the 7,595 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Golden Ocean Group (GOGL)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$378M — down 23% from $493M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 47 funds closed out of GOGL and 35 opened new positions — a net loss of 12 holders — while 63 trimmed existing stakes and 43 added.
The largest buyer was FourWorld Capital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$19M. The largest seller was Mirae Asset Global ETFs Holdings, cutting an estimated $19.6M.
